Supersport ‘returns’ for ZPSL Week 22

Supersport is set to screen Castle Lager Premiership action this weekend after going over a month without broadcasting local matches.

The league’s broadcasting deal with the Pay TV has been questioned by fans over the lack of consistency in showing ZPSL matches.

Earlier in the season Supersport only started broadcast matches weeks into the season after a required licence took time to be issued.

The current deal signed is set to expire at the end of the 2017 league season

According to the PSL the agreement with Supersport does not mean all matches are broadcast on their television networks despite being an exclusive rights deal.

However this weekend two matches are scheduled to be shown live in Bulawayo. Bulawayo City’s clash with Harare City is set to be screened followed by Highlanders’ match against Tsholotsho.
